Jeff Immelt, chairman and CEO of General Electric, speaks at the Haas School of Business, UC Berkeley. He discusses how GE drives innovation and growth on a large scale in such diverse fields as energy and health care. Immelt also offers advice to students on becoming leaders in today's global marketplace. (September 09, 2008) The University of California Berkeley Haas School of Business is one of the world's leading producers of new ideas and knowledge in all areas of business - which includes the distinction of having two of its faculty members receive the Nobel Prize in Economics over the past 15 years. The school offers six degree-granting programs. Its mission is to develop innovative business leaders - individuals who redefine how we do business by putting new ideas into action, and who do so responsibly. The school's distinctive culture is defined by four key principles - question the status quo; confidence without attitude; students always; and, beyond yourself.
